A lot of the bars in the Denver area host NL Hold 'Em tourneys. There is no entry fee (therefore, no consideration), but the D.A. is still leaning on the games, trying to get them stopped. According to the D.A., because the bars are getting residual sales from the poker tourneys, they are profiting from gambling. However, the law seems to state otherwise.
